Output d77baa2d073da6179028cbf0c8e3592440d1602a245c3d2006b94b90dfc9b6cd:6

value
32698065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f524ff69b14282288d216faf4e14ea988103b14a OP_EQUAL
address
3Q3DoBrR5e8wCfaKtizmK7U4mv4vfFdnFb
transaction
d77baa2d073da6179028cbf0c8e3592440d1602a245c3d2006b94b90dfc9b6cd
spent
true